The desktop product needs a repeatable local gate that can prove the core Coding Agent loop still works after changes, not only that unit tests pass. This adds a quality-gate runner with PR, baseline, and release modes, structured reports, explicit quarantine metadata, and fixture-based live baseline cases that can run across provider/model targets.
